Fiat Coupé

The Fiat Coupé is a four-seat sedan produced from 1993, measuring 4,250 mm in length and weighing 1,225 kg. It is powered by a 1.9-litre engine and achieves a top speed of 240 km/h.

Common problems & reliability
In the UK, 70% of Fiat Coupés pass their MOT test first time, based on 862 inspections.
Based on real owner complaints and inspection data — not an editorial rating. Sources: DVSA MOT (UK, Open Government Licence).
